President Donald Trump’s FBI Director, Kash Patel, has uncovered thousands of documents tied to the Russia probe hidden in burn bags inside a secret room of the bureau’s headquarters.

The documents include the classified annex to former Special Counsel John Durham’s final report, which contains the raw intelligence Durham reviewed during his investigation into the FBI’s handling of the 2016 Trump campaign.

Durham previously concluded that the FBI never should have launched its original Trump-Russia investigation, known as Crossfire Hurricane, citing lack of credible evidence.

A source familiar with the discovery told the Daily Mail the documents were likely overlooked by past directors and may have been destroyed if not for Patel’s ongoing efforts to audit the bureau.

The materials have been handed over to Iowa Sen. Chuck Grassley (R), chairman of the Senate Judiciary Committee.

The FBI says the documents will be released publicly later today.

Trump gave his full support to the release. “I want everything to be shown, as long as it is fair and reasonable,” he said.

“I would like to see people exposed that might be bad, and we’ll see how that all works out,” Trump said during a press briefing at the White House.
